Filter

    Delma 41501.670.6.034 Shell Star Decompression Timer Automatic Watch
    Delma
    £1,147.00
    Delma 41501.670.6.031 Shell Star Automatic Watch
    Delma
    £1,070.00
    Delma 31601.726.6.144 Cayman Bronze Limited Edition Watch
    Delma
    £1,475.00
    Delma 31601.726.6.104 Cayman Bronze Limited Edition Watch
    Delma
    £1,475.00
    Delma 31601.726.6.044 Cayman Bronze Limited Edition Watch
    Delma
    £1,475.00
    Delma 31601.726.6.034 Cayman Bronze Limited Edition Watch
    Delma
    £1,475.00